How to Fix Slow Response Times in a Discord Community When the Answer Lives in Another Team
Most unanswered questions are not a moderator shortage. They are waiting on fulfillment, finance or engineering, and what breaks changes at every size of community.

| If you want to know how to fix slow response times in a Discord community, stop counting moderators and start sorting questions. Many of the ones that sit for days cannot be answered by anybody in the chat, because they need fulfillment, finance or engineering to check something. Measure first response and resolution separately, then give every outside topic a named owner and a stated turnaround. |

The short answer
Sort your unanswered questions into two piles before you change anything else. Pile one is everything a person in the server could have answered with what they already know. Pile two is everything that required somebody outside the server to go and look something up. Where is my order. Why was I charged twice. When does the fix ship. Is my refund approved. Pile one is a staffing and coverage problem, and more people or better hours will fix it. Pile two will not move no matter how many moderators you add, because the moderators were never the bottleneck. They were waiting, exactly like the member was. Most teams never do this sort. They see a slow number, assume the community team is understaffed, hire another moderator, and the number barely moves. Then the community team gets treated as the underperformer, when the delay was sitting in a queue two departments away the whole time.
A moderator who cannot answer a question is not slow. They are blocked, and blocked is a different problem with a different fix.
Two clocks, not one
The single reason this stays invisible is that most communities report one number. Average response time. It blends two things that belong to two different owners.
| Clock | What it measures | Who owns it | What actually fixes it |
|---|---|---|---|
| Time to first human response | How long before a real person acknowledges the member | The community team | Coverage hours, staffing, alerting |
| Time to resolution | How long before the member has their actual answer | The business function that holds the answer | Named owners, agreed turnarounds, escalation paths |
Split them and the conversation changes immediately. A first response time of a few minutes and a resolution time of four days tells you the community team is doing its job and the handoff behind it is broken. A first response time of a day tells you the opposite. One blended number tells you nothing and quietly assigns blame to whoever is closest to the member. Track them separately from this week, even if you do it by hand in a spreadsheet. The split is worth more than any tooling you might buy.
Under 1,000 members: the shoulder tap still works
At this size one person usually answers everything. When a question needs somebody else, they walk over, send a message, and get an answer because the company is small enough that everyone knows everyone and nobody wants to be the person who ignored a customer. Nothing formal is needed here and building it early is wasted effort. What you should do at this size is start writing down which questions had to leave the server and who answered them. It takes seconds and it becomes the foundation for everything below. The list you keep at 500 members is what saves you at 10,000. The failure at this size is not slowness. It is that nothing gets recorded, so when the volume arrives there is no map of who answers what.
Around 1,000 members: the favour economy breaks
This is the first real threshold, and it catches most teams by surprise because nothing dramatic happens. Volume just crosses the point where asking colleagues for help stops being occasional and starts being constant. Now the requests are a stream of direct messages to people who never agreed to be part of the support process. They answer when they have time, which means the member's wait depends on somebody else's calendar. Nobody is behaving badly. The arrangement simply has no agreement inside it. What to put in place here:
- One shared place where outside questions go, not personal direct messages.
- A short written note of who answers what, agreed with those people rather than assumed.
- A rough expectation of how long each type takes, so the community team can tell the member something true. That last point matters more than it sounds. "Someone is checking, you will hear back today" holds a member. Silence does not, and silence is what you get when the community team has no idea how long the other team will take.
Around 10,000 members: named owners and stated turnarounds
At this size goodwill stops being enough and the structure has to become explicit. Every category of outside question gets one named owner and one stated turnaround. Not a rota of moderators. A person in fulfillment who owns order questions. A person in engineering who owns bug confirmations. A person in finance who owns billing disputes. Write it as a plain table that anybody can read:
| Question Type | Owner (Role) | Answer Within |
|---|---|---|
| Order and delivery | Fulfillment coordinator | 1 business day |
| Billing and refunds | Finance operations | 2 business days |
| Bug confirmation | Engineering on-call | 1 business day |
| Account and access | Support lead | 4 hours |
| Legal and policy | Operations manager | 3 business days |
Two things make this work. The turnaround is agreed by the owner rather than imposed on them, and the community team is allowed to say the turnaround out loud to the member. A member told "billing questions come back within two working days" waits calmly. The same member with no information assumes they were ignored and says so publicly. This is also the size where the community team should stop being measured on resolution time for things it cannot resolve. Report the two clocks separately at this point or the wrong team keeps absorbing the criticism.
100,000 members and above: escalation has to become a ticket
At large scale, a message asking a colleague for a favour stops surviving contact with volume. The owner has their own queue, their own priorities and their own manager, and a request that lives in a chat message loses to a request that lives in their own system. So the escalation stops being a message and becomes a record in the receiving team's tooling, created automatically, carrying the member's context, with a state the community team can read without asking. The community side keeps one thread with the member and one link to that record.
What changes concretely at this scale?
- Escalations are created as records in the owning team's system rather than sent as messages.
- Each record carries the member reference, the question, and what has already been checked, so nobody re-asks.
- The community team can see the state of every open escalation without pinging anyone.
- Anything past its stated turnaround appears on a list that a manager reviews, not in somebody's memory. The cost of getting this wrong grows with size in a way that is easy to miss. At a thousand members a dropped escalation is one annoyed person. At scale it is a visible thread that other members read, answer for you incorrectly, and remember.
The one week audit
You do not need any of the above to start. You need one week of honest tagging, and it costs nothing.
- For seven days, log every question that did not get resolved the same day.
- Against each one, write the team that would have had to answer it.
- Mark whether the member got any human acknowledgement while they waited.
- At the end of the week, count the entries by team rather than by day.
- Take the two teams with the most entries and agree a named owner and a turnaround with each. What comes back is almost never a list of community problems. It is a picture of which parts of the business your members are actually waiting on, and it is far more persuasive in a leadership conversation than any request for another moderator.
What this layer sits inside
Escalation is one layer of response time and it is the one most often missed, but it is not the whole system. Coverage hours decide whether anybody is awake when the question arrives. Channel and role architecture decides whether the question lands somewhere visible. Documentation decides how many questions never need a human. Automation decides what gets acknowledged instantly. Reporting decides whether any of it is visible to the people funding it. Fix escalation and the questions that need another department stop disappearing. The other layers stay exactly as built or unbuilt as they were, and it is worth knowing which of them you have.
The fastest support teams are not the ones that type quickest. They are the ones where every question already has a person whose job it is to answer it. Read more at danieljeong.org.
